DescriptionMargaret Elwyn Sparshott (1).jpg | Margaret Elwyn Sparshott (Seychelles 1871 – 1940), matron of Manchester Royal Infirmary, England, between 1907 and 1929. She was a daughter of Reverend Thomas Henry Sparshott (1841–1927). | |||||
